    Abstract: A stator for rotary electric machines is provided, in which a volume occupied by winding portions may be increased and a connecting wire may readily be engaged to prevent from coming off. A plurality of connecting wire engaging hooks 23, with which the connecting wire extending from the winding portion is engaged, are respectively disposed in the vicinity of border portions between a plurality of magnetic pole sections 11 and a yoke 9, corresponding to the magnetic pole sections 11. A mounting location of a connector 29 on a circuit substrate 7 is determined so that all of ends of a plurality of terminal conductors of the connector may be located between adjoining two of the connecting wire engaging hooks 23. With this arrangement, all of the ends 31a of the plurality of terminal conductors 31 may be disposed between adjoining two of a plurality of the winding portions 3, and be spaced from the winding portions 3.

    Abstract: The present invention provides a rotary electric machine, of which the occupied volume can be reduced and which allows a space in an electric apparatus equipped therewith to be utilized effectively. A slot insulator 15 is integrally formed with a holder mounting portion 25, a whole or major part of which is positioned on one of end faces of a yoke 11 of a stator core 7. A lead wire holder 27 includes a connection holding portion 27a for disposing a plurality of connections 30, in which lead-out wires of windings are connected with corresponding core wires 29a of lead wires 29, at a predetermined interval so that the connections do not contact with each other. The lead wire holder 27 is arranged so that the connection holding portion 27a is positioned over a part of the windings 9 and the holder mounting portion 25 when the lead wire holder is attached to the holder mounting portion 25.
